The Squallgate fan-out pushes weather alerts from the Tempest ingest queue to regional subscriber shards. Read the shard-routing notes before touching partition logic; misrouted alerts silently drop. Retry semantics are at-least-once, so downstream consumers must dedupe. Historical design debates (batching vs. streaming) are archived in the Brinewood wiki. Load-test configs live alongside the deploy manifests. The canonical architecture overview, including sequence diagrams and failure-mode tables, is on the internal page below.

operations page: https://jenkins.zemvarcloud.local/job/merge_requests/repo/build/73930b4b30f0a8ed

**Vendor note: Inkmill markdown pipeline**

Rendering for Parchway docs is outsourced to Inkmill under an annual contract, renewing each March. They handle sanitization and PDF export; we own the upload queue. SLA: 4-hour response on rendering failures. Escalate only after two failed retries. Their support desk is reachable at the address below.

billing contact of hahaf-baguf = zorael.tammir.jorius@sivrelhq.internal

### CSV Import Wizard

The Fieldrow import wizard validates headers, then streams rows in 500-row chunks. Failed chunks go to the quarantine table; they do not block the batch. Before release, verify the quarantine drain job ran clean and the header mapping version matches the schema tag. No manual table edits. Mapping versions and drain procedures are documented on the internal page.

wiki page, yahif-kaguf: https://jira.zemvarworks.corp/dash/dash/display/cbf08b2b7e55